Miosis, or myosis (from ancient greek μύειν (múein) 'to close the eyes'), is excessive constriction of the pupil Miosis is a state in which the pupils of the eyes are too small, either in darkness or light [1][2][3][4] the opposite condition, mydriasis, is the dilation of the pupil.
When your pupil shrinks (constricts), it's called miosis
If your pupils stay small even in dim light, it can be a sign that things in your eye aren't working the way they should.
